200244200 has 48 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 501387180. Its totient is φ = 73935360.
The previous prime is 200244197. The next prime is 200244203. The reversal of 200244200 is 2442002.
It is a happy number.
It is an interprime number because it is at equal distance from previous prime (200244197) and next prime (200244203).
It can be written as a sum of positive squares in 6 ways, for example, as 90288004 + 109956196 = 9502^2 + 10486^2 .
200244200 is a modest number, since divided by 244200 gives 200 as remainder.
It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(200244203)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 11 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 35909 + ... + 41108.
Almost surely, 2200244200 is an apocalyptic number.
200244200 is a gapful number since it is divisible by the number (20) formed by its first and last digit.
It is an amenable number.
200244200 is an abundant number, since it is smaller than the sum of its proper divisors (301142980).
It is a pseudoperfect number, because it is the sum of a subset of its proper divisors.
200244200 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
200244200 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The sum of its prime factors is 77046 (or 77037 counting only the distinct ones).
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 128, while the sum is 14.
The square root of 200244200 is about 14150.7667636775. The cubic root of 200244200 is about 585.0414658800.
Adding to 200244200 its reverse (2442002), we get a palindrome (202686202).
The spelling of 200244200 in words is "two hundred million, two hundred forty-four thousand, two hundred".
